  1. 8.  Jermain Erving Whitehouse was born on 7 Jul 1845 in Oswego, Oswego, New York, USA (son of Stoel Whitehouse and Janet "Jeannette" Campbell); died on 11 Mar 1923 in Houston, Houston, Minnesota, USA; was buried in Money Creek Cemetery, Houston, Minnesota, USA.

    Other Events and Attributes:

    • Residence: 1850, Scriba, Oswego, New York, USA
    • Residence: 1860, Hamilton, Houston, Minnesota, USA
    • Military Service: 1 Feb 1864, Houston, Houston, Minnesota, USA
    • Residence: 1870, Money Creek, Houston, Minnesota, USA
    • Residence: 1 May 1885, Money Creek, Houston, Minnesota, USA
    • Residence: 1900, Houston Village, Houston, Minnesota, USA
    • Residence: 1910, Houston, Houston, Minnesota, USA
    • Residence: 1920, Houston, Houston, Minnesota, USA

    Notes:

    Military Service:
    Enters the war as a private in the First Battery of Light Artillery. Fought for General Sherman at the Battle of Atlanta and on the March to the Sea. Is mustered out 30 Jun 1865.

    Residence:
    Hazel and Vernon are with their parents; also in residence is Cathren Taft, Ella's mother.

    Residence:
    Their granddaughter Ivia Burfield, age 27, is living with them. Ivia is the daughter of Ella's girl, Emily Pearl.

    Jermain married Ella Relief Taft Whtiney on 29 Sep 1888 in La Crosse, La Crosse, Wisconsin, USA. Ella was born on 1 Jun 1853 in Seneca Falls, Seneca, New York, USA; died in 1933 in St Paul, Ramsey, Minnesota, USA. [Group Sheet] [Family Chart]
